Mogroside V
Mogroside V is extracted from the fruit of Siraitia grosvenorii Swingle. It is 300 times sweeter than cane sugar and low in calories. It had a significant effect on insulin secretion and confirmed that the natural sweetener LHK could be beneficial for use by diabetic populations. Studies have found that mogrosides V have strong sweetness and functional effects. molecular sieve
Sodium aluminosilicate is a fine white powder. Many ordinary rocks (feldspars) are aluminosilicates. Aluminosilicates with more open three-dimensional structures than the feldspars are called zeolites. The openings in zeolites appear as polyhedral cavities connected by tunnels. Zeolites act as catalysts by absorbing small molecules in their interior cavities and holding them in proximity so that reaction among them occurs sooner.;DryPowder; DryPowder, OtherSolid; OtherSolid; PelletsLargeCrystals. Molidustat
Molidustat (BAY 85-3934) is an orally active inhibitor of hypoxia-inducible factor prolyl hydroxylase ( HIF-PH ) with IC 50 values of 480 nM, 280 nM, and 450 nM for PHD1 , PHD2 , and PHD3 , respectively. Molidustat can elevate the levels of circulating erythropoietin (EPO) to near-normal physiological ranges. Molidustat can be utilized in the research of renal anemia [1] [2]. Mollugin
Mollugin is an orally active and potent NF-κB inhibitor. Mollugin induces S-phase arrest of HepG2 cells, and increased intracellular reactive oxygen species (ROS) levels. Mollugin induces DNA damage in HepG2 cells, as well as an increase in the expression of p-H2AX. Mollugin shows anti-cancer effect by inhibiting TNF-α-induced NF-κB activation. Mollugin enhances the osteogenic action of BMP-2 (bone morphogenetic protein 2) via the p38-Smad signaling pathway. Uses: Designed for use in research and industrial production. Molnupiravir
Molnupiravir (EIDD-2801) is an orally bioavailable proagent of the ribonucleoside analog EIDD-1931. Molnupiravir has broad spectrum antiviral activity against influenza virus and multiple coronaviruses , such as SARS-CoV-2 , MERS-CoV , SARS-CoV. Molnupiravir has the potential for the research of COVID-19, and seasonal and pandemic influenza [1] [2]. Uses: Scientific research. Group: Signaling pathways. Alternative Names: EIDD-2801; MK-4482.
